The Rickey Russet potato is a variety of Russet potato known for its high yield, excellent storage qualities, and uniform shape. It is commonly used for baking, mashing, and making French fries due to its high starch content.
The Rickey Russet variety is often grown in regions with cooler climates, as it requires a long growing season for optimal yield and quality. It is popular among both home gardeners and commercial growers due to its robustness and high performance in storage.
